On August 8, 1977, Waylon Todd Reno was born the first child of Joyce and Bill Reno. Waylon was born and raised in Miles City but he was by nature a country kid, loving the time he spent with his maternal grandparents, Jim and Bertha Roufley near Brusett, Montana.
Often, when he was outside, playing, he would encounter a water puddle and couldn’t help himself. He had to wade through it and if splashing was involved, all the better. Mom would chastise him but she knew full well he was just being a boy.
His elementary and secondary education was in the Miles City school district, eventually graduating from Miles Community College with an emphasis in mechanics but he preferred being outdoors more than schoolwork.
His first job, during his high school years, was at Friendship Villa where he enjoyed caring for the residents. He moved on to working for Blue Rock Distributing. The Bakken Oil field was in full swing and called him to join it. He operated a chemical van and other jobs for SanJel for a couple of years. He returned to Miles City and became a truck driver for Bill Eckart of Eckart Trucking, a job he truly loved and was his occupation until his untimely passing.
Waylon packed a lot of life into his short time here on earth. He loved to hunt and fish. His fall days were often filled with hunting deer, elk and prairie dogs with fishing filling any available time. He loved watching wrestling and football, with his very favorite Professional team being the Dallas Cowboys, a team he rarely missed when they were on tv.
During the time when the trucking was at a standstill, he enjoyed working with Jeremy Schell at his meat processing plant on Tongue River road. This also gave him more opportunities to hunt with Jeremy and other friends.
Waylon was well known for his happy go lucky attitude and ready wit and was always willing to help anyone with anything at any time. Hard work was his lifestyle, and he did it with a passion.
He was preceded in death by his grandparents, Jim and Bertha Roufley, and Clarence and Irene Reno, his father Bill and his step grandmother Bonnie Holmlund and numerous aunts and uncles.
He is survived by his children Tristan, Bailey and Riley, Mother Joyce and step father Ken, sister Joni Hauber (Mike) and their sons Trevor and Jax and numerous cousins and relatives and his greatly loved pet “my puppy Tessy” who he often visited at Joni’s house.
